Sailing into new markets

A SOFTWARE firm has landed a deal with Britain’s Americas Cup sailing team and is looking to grow its workforce by around 50% as it develops a new cloud computing service.

Gateshead’s Orchid Software has won a contract as the preferred intranet provider to TEAMORIGIN, the sailing team created by entrepreneur and former international president of the London 2012 Olmpics bid, Sir Keith Mills.

The team’s commercial arm will use the Tyneside firm’s Orchidnet product to manage its back-office duties.

Meanwhile, £1.5m-a-year Orchid is looking to add up to 10 new member of staff to its 19-strong workforce in the next year as it prepares for the mid-2011 launch of a new ‘software as a service’ (SAS) product which businesses can access remotely online.

Orchid’s current list of clients includes clothing brand Jack Wills, Lancashire Teaching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ust and the Royal Academy of Music, while historically it has worked with the likes of Greggs and Nissan.

TEAMORIGIN was formed in January 2007 by Sir Keith Mills, who was instrumental in bringing the Olympic Games back to the Great Britain for the first time since 1948.

The team is backed up by athletes such as team Skipper and Helmsman - and three times Olympic Gold medallist - Ben Ainslie.

Orchid’s managing director Ajay Sood said: “TEAMORIGIN is a globally-renowned name in the sporting arena, and we look forward to supporting their efforts in the best way we know how –by providing a world-class intranet for their business operations.”
